ATK Wins $5.8 Million Contract to Supply Ammunition to the Crane Division of the...
MINNEAPOLIS -- Alliant Techsystems (NYSE: ATK) has received a $5.8 million contract for ammunition from the Crane Division of the Naval Surface Warfare Center. The contract is for the production of Mk318 5.56mm and Mk319 7.62mm caliber cartridges. The ammunition will be manufactured in Anoka, Minn.

Taurus Judge: Gun Tests Revolver of the Year 2009
Every December Gun Tests Magazine picks the best from a full year’s worth of tests and distills summary recommendations for readers, who often use them as year-end shopping guides. These “best of” choices are a mixture of the Gun Tests original evaluation and other information the staff compiles during the year.Additionally, the magazine selects the best type of firearm--pistol, revolver, shotgun, and rifle--for its “Best in Class” award.The “Best in Class” Revolver for 2009 was the Taurus Judge No. 4510TKR-3BUL 3-Inch 45 LC/410-Bore, $620. It was originally reviewed in the August 2009 issue.
